Team,

As part of Friday's disaster-recovery drill, we'll replay the conditions from the Fernwick stale-cache postmortem: the invalidation worker will be paused so cached order statuses drift out of date. Support should practice identifying the drift and escalating per the runbook. If the admin panel session expires during the drill, re-authenticate with the recovery passphrase noted directly below.

vault phrase of bagaf-kajeg = jorath-feniel-briir-siliel-ralix

For sales leads ahead of the quarterly leadership review: gross margin across the Harlowe product line slipped 2.3 points, driven mainly by discounting on multi-year deals and rising fulfilment costs out of the Corven depot. Services margin held steady. Expect questions on deal-level pricing discipline; bring your exception logs. A revised discount matrix will be circulated after the review, along with updated quota guidance. One element of the plan is restricted to this group and is set out directly below.

board note of bawep-tajef: Queniusek Systems plans to raise the Quenvan list price by 53.1 percent in March. The pricing group signed off on a budget of $176.4 million for Project Drueth. The renewal with Casionix Partners closes at $142.5 million a year, 8.3 percent below the last contract. Project Fraax slips by six weeks because of the tooling delay.

Welcome aboard — before touching the Larkspur public API, read this. Pagination is cursor-based everywhere except the legacy /v1/invoices endpoint, which still uses page/limit and must not be changed without a deprecation notice. Cursors are opaque base64 blobs; never parse them client-side, and never assume stable ordering without an explicit sort param. Max page size is 200, enforced server-side. The design rationale, edge cases, and migration plan are documented on the internal wiki page below.

wiki page, tahaf-tajog: https://jira.ordindyn.corp/pipeline

Checklist item 7: Confirm the Oxbill service now builds under the Hermata hermetic toolchain with network fetches disabled. All third-party deps must resolve from the pinned vault snapshot; any escape-hatch fetch flags are a release blocker. Security review requires the reproducibility diff to be empty across two clean builders in the Tarn enclave. Attach the deterministic build token produced by the second builder below.

pipeline stamp: htk9_ce63042d9